Definition

To pass down from generation to generation, usually referring to objects, customs, or stories.

neutralpeopleother

How it's used

Focuses on the continuity of intangible heritage like skills, values, or family legends rather than physical property. It carries a sense of duty or cultural pride, often used when discussing traditions that are at risk of being lost. While it sounds slightly formal, it is frequently used in documentaries or serious family discussions.
